Featured dishes

View full menu
Louisiana Crab Cake
Blue crab claw meat mixed with seasoned onion, green pepper, and celery. Grilled golden brown and served with house made lemon dill aioli and pickled red onion
Steamer Clam
One pound of clams steamed in lobster butter broth with fresh garlic, white wine and chopped fresh basil
Bloody Mary Prawn Cocktail
Six large grilled prawns, chilled and served with our house made bloody mary cocktail sauce garnished with assorted pickled vegetable and crisp bacon strip
Sautéed Mushroom
Button mushrooms sautéed with butter and garlic then simmered with fresh thyme in sherry wine and demi glaze sauce. Finished with parmesan cheese
Grilled Prawn Salad
Six chargrilled prawns with mixed greens, tomato, cucumber, kalamata olive, shaved red onion, and croutons

Matthew ChenMatthew Chen
I stopped at Wild Huckleberry for breakfast with my family before a long drive. The food was great and the service was even better. The prices are pretty low for the huge portions, too. I would definitely come back. The food was delicious and the "sides" that come with them are huge. I ordered an omelette with biscuits and gravy. The biscuit was nice and soft and there was more than enough gravy for them. My wife got the cinnamon roll French toast. She said that it didn't really seem like a cinnamon roll, but it was good and very flavorful. She wasn't able to finish it, though not for lack of trying. My kids each got bacon or sausage with an egg and a pancake on the side. They were the biggest pancakes I've ever gotten at a restaurant! The building is a converted house, so it's different from your typical restaurant. The architecture and decor are interesting and the seating is separated into multiple rooms, so it feels more cozy (in a good way). We got there right when they opened so we didn't have to wait, but there is a large bookshelf with kids toys in the waiting area. When the waitress brought water for the kids, their straws had little pinwheels attached. They loved them!
Brian LunBrian Lun
We rode through on a Saturday morning on our bikes. The place was busy at 10am, but we got a table no problem. It looked pretty busy behind us though. Atmosphere is great. I had the small order of the veggie eggs Benedict, with hash browns. The veggie Benedict was loaded up with veggies, and was decent, but a little bland. The hashbrowns were good - crispy on the outside, not too greasy. The potatoes on the inside were soft, but I would have liked them a little crispier. Others in my group ordered the bacon and eggs. They are generous with the bacon (4 strips). If you order the pancake as the side, you get a ginormous portion of a single pancake, and it is quite delicious. The fruit bowl was pretty good with a good mix of veggies (honey dew, raspberries, blackberries, grapes). The service was great. Our server kept topping us all our coffees. Food was out quick. Worth checking out.

The only times I go on Google to leave reviews is when:

I feel a place is so bad that it’s only right of me to warn people. A place is so exceptionally good that it demands my endorsement. (Only has happened 1-2 times)

If you find yourself in Wenatchee, go to Wild Huckleberry.

The Diverse dinner menu looks pricey at first but the quality and value far outweighs the cost.

Each dinner entree comes with 1. Your meal 2. A quality side salad (no iceberg lettuce) 3. A loaf of homemade bread (amazing) and 2 sides. I had the chicken Marsala and every element of the meal was expertly crafted.

The service was even better. We sat in a separate room from the main area and our waiter set it up to be candlelit and treated us like we were VIP guests the whole night. In fact the whole staff asked us how our time was at one point or another, and did the little things to make it special.

The atmosphere was homey, seasonal (we came in October), but also intimate. The Restaurant itself is built into an only old house right in the middle of Downtown with plenty of free parking on the street and in small lots nearby.

The menu has a good variety of quality steaks, seafood, chicken, and pasta dishes all of which looked amazing promising return trips with the same quality and value as our first. The craziest part is they have only been serving dinner for a year!

The only other time I have felt this good about a Restaurant experience is at a very fancy fine dining establishment in Seattle. Please treat yourself to Wild Huckleberry as...
